      <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Repairing Broken Tilt and Turn Windows: A Comprehensive Guide</p>

<hr>

<p>Tilt and turn windows are a preferred among property owners for their versatile style, permitting both inward tilting for ventilation and complete opening for easy cleansing and gain access to. However, like any window system, they can experience issues over time. Comprehending how to repair damaged tilt and turn windows not just saves money on repair expenses but also ensures the durability and functionality of this practical window type. This guide provides an in-depth overview of typical problems, repair techniques, and maintenance ideas for tilt and turn windows.</p>

<p>Step-by-Step Repair Guide</p>

<hr>

<p>Now that you are geared up with the required tools and knowledge, follow these detailed actions for fixing your tilt and turn windows.</p>

<h3 id="step-1-diagnose-the-problem" id="step-1-diagnose-the-problem">Step 1: Diagnose the Problem</h3>

<p>Start by identifying the particular issue impacting your window. Inspect for noticeable indications such as misaligned frames, rust on the hardware, or harmed seals. Evaluate the operation of the window by attempting both the tilt and turn functions.</p>

<h3 id="action-2-open-the-window" id="action-2-open-the-window">Action 2: Open the Window</h3>

<p>Make sure the window is completely closed before continuing with repairs. This will make sure security and ease of gain access to.</p>

<h3 id="action-3-adjust-the-hinges" id="action-3-adjust-the-hinges">Action 3: Adjust the Hinges</h3>

<p>If the window is misaligned (will not open appropriately):</p>
<ol><li>Use a screwdriver to loosen up the hinge screws slightly.</li>
<li>Adjust the window frame&#39;s position to align it straight.</li>
<li>Retighten the screws once the window is aligned.</li></ol>

<h3 id="step-4-replace-worn-hardware" id="step-4-replace-worn-hardware">Step 4: Replace Worn Hardware</h3>

<p>For broken or used locks and hinges:</p>
<ol><li>Remove the harmed hardware by loosening it.</li>
<li>Set up the new hardware, making sure it is compatible with your window design.</li>
<li>Check the locking mechanism to guarantee it operates properly.</li></ol>

<h3 id="step-5-seal-air-leaks" id="step-5-seal-air-leaks">Step 5: Seal Air Leaks</h3>

<p>For drafts and air leaks:</p>
<ol><li>Inspect the weatherstripping around the edges of the window.</li>
<li>Change any worn or harmed strips.</li>
<li>Use a fresh layer of caulk around the window frame, smoothing it with an energy knife.</li></ol>

<h3 id="step-6-clean-and-lubricate" id="step-6-clean-and-lubricate">Step 6: Clean and Lubricate</h3>

<p>To facilitate smooth operation:</p>
<ol><li>Clean any dirt or debris from the window tracks and frame.</li>
<li>Apply lube to hinges and moving parts to avoid tightness.</li></ol>

<h3 id="step-7-final-checks" id="step-7-final-checks">Step 7: Final Checks</h3>

<p>After making the repairs, inspect the window operation again. Make sure that it opens and closes smoothly, locks securely, and is effectively sealed versus drafts.</p>

<p>Preventative Maintenance Tips</p>

<hr>

<p>To prolong the life of your tilt and turn windows, think about following these upkeep tips:</p>
<ol><li><strong>Regular Cleaning</strong>: Keep the frames and glass clean to avoid dirt buildup.</li>
<li><strong>Check Annually</strong>: Look for indications of wear on seals, hinges, and locks.</li>
<li><strong>Lube Moving Parts</strong>: Do this at least as soon as a year to keep the window functioning smoothly.</li>
<li><strong>Weatherstripping Replacement</strong>: Replace weatherstripping as needed, specifically before winter.</li>
<li><strong>Professional Inspections</strong>: Consider having an expert check the windows every few years to catch prospective issues early.</li></ol>
